Bor Kee Electroplating Factory LimitedBor Kee Electroplating Factory Limited

Contact:
Ms Shirley Wong, General Manager
Tel: (852) 2889-7197  Fax: (852) 2515-3012  E-mail: shirley@borkee.com.hk

Office Reduce Policy
Reduce Electricity Consumption

  • Set air-conditioning temperature at 23-25 degrees
  • Set up automated standby energy saving mode after computer idle for 5 mins
  • Post energy saving reminder stickers in the office
  • Regular cleaning of air-conditioners to reduce power consumption due to increased contamination
  • Lighting control, reduce the use of unnecessary lights (Only install two fluorescent tubes to some light troughs)

Reduce Water Consumption

  • Post water saving reminder stickers in the washrooms
  • Regular checking for water leakage

Factory Reduce Policy

  • Using light sensor at pantry to avoid colleague forget turn light off when leaving
  • Using cold and heat exchange system to save energy up to 50%
  • Using environmentally friendly equipments on production lines to save energy can up to 40% compared with the traditional equipment
  • Using magnetic switches to replace mechanic switches to protect all equipments from damage during sudden electricity pause. Plus avoid equipment switch on automatic by itself when electricity come back

Reduce Water Waste

  • Using water sensors on production line for cleaning to avoid running water on all the time
  • Installing water drop receiver in between tank to tank let the excess water go back to the tank, avoid water drop on the floor.
  • Plus do well on water pipe maintenance to avoid leakage

Business Environment Council Business Environment Council Limited

Contact:
Ms. Tracy Chow, Senior Manager - Communications
Tel: (852) 2784-3912   Fax: (852) 2784-6699   E-mail: tracychow@bec.org.hk
  • BEC Headquarters have achieved the provisional Platinum rating under the BEAM Plus Assessment of existing buildings, after upgrading of green features to the building.  It was the first existing commercial building in Hong Kong to achieve this recognition.

Energy Saving

  • Replaced one conventional air-cooled chiller to oil-free variable speed air-cooled chiller
  • Replaced T8 fluorescent tubes with LED panels
  • Installed photo and occupancy sensors to reduce the energy use of the lighting system
  • Retro-commissioning the major building services system to ensure they are operating in the optimal conditions
  • In the future, solar films will be applied on the East and West facades to reduce solar heat gain

Water Saving

  • Installed a 6000-litre rainwater collection tank with a sterilization and water pump system
  • Installed low flow water taps and dual-flush systems in the washrooms

Green Office Initiatives

  • Organise ‘stair-day’ to reduce the electricity use by the lift
  • Stick label to remind staff members to turn off the lighting and computer monitor when leaving the office, and keep the temperature at 25oC
  • Switch off the office lighting during lunch hour
